如果你学python想选择一个好IDE的话,那么pycharm将是一个不错选择。这款软件可以有效提高你工作效率,PyCharm是一种Python IDE,带有一整套可以帮助用户在使用Python语言开发时提高其效率工具,比如调试、语法高亮、Project管理、代码跳转、智能提示、自动完成、单元测试、版本控制。此外,该IDE提供了一些高级功能,以用于支持Django框架下专业Web开发。
转载 2024-05-09 22:08:02
53阅读
使用阿里云服务器ECS,远程服务器IP地址xxxxx1、配置PyCharm与服务器代码同步打开Tools | Deployment | Configuration点击左边“+”添加一个部署配置,输入名字,类型选SFTP 2、确配置远程服务器ip、端口、用户名和密码。root path是文件上传根目录,注意这个目录必须用户名有权限创建文件。sftp host填写远程服务器IP,u
转载 2024-01-06 06:05:29
215阅读
# Pycharm同步Docker使用指南 在现代软件开发中,Docker已经成为了一种流行工具,用于封装、分发和运行应用程序。PyCharm是一个强大Python IDE,能够帮助开发者更高效地进行开发工作。本篇文章将详细介绍如何在PyCharm同步Docker容器,以便轻松地管理和开发Python应用程序,并提供详细代码示例、甘特图和关系图。 ## 什么是Docker? Doc
原创 2024-09-12 03:10:18
58阅读
1. 建立远程python interpreter建议先建立一个用于远程调试ssh interpreter,这步完成之后会自动生成一个代码同步配置。然后我们再直接使用建立远程interpreter进行代码同步。参考链接 注:每建立一个ssh interpreter,pycharm都会生成一个名为user@ip自动代码同步配置,建议重命名以进行区分。2. 设置代码同步如果已经建立了ssh
在讨论“pycharm中pythonproject作用”之前,我们首先明确了什么是 Python 项目以及它在 PyCharm IDE 中功能和重要性。一个 Python 项目通常包含一系列 Python 文件、所有相关库、资源以及配置文件。在 PyCharm 中,Python 项目的设置可以极大地提升开发效率,提供更好代码管理与调试功能。 在协议背景部分,我们可以将其结构划分为关系图
原创 6月前
44阅读
Redis是一种高性能内存数据库;而MySQL是基于磁盘文件关系型数据库,相比于Redis来说,读取速度会慢一些,但是功能强大,可以用于存储持久化数据。在实际工作中,我们常常将Redis作为缓存与MySQL配合来使用,当有数据访问请求时候,首先会从缓存中进行查找,如果存在就直接取出,如果不存在再访问数据库,这样就提升了读取效率,也减少了堆后端数据库访问压力。可以说使用Redis这种缓存
转载 2023-12-09 22:09:01
83阅读
Python中使用Queue和Condition进行线程同步方法这篇文章主要介绍了Python中使用Queue模块和Condition对象进行线程同步方法,配合threading模块下线程编程进行操作实例,需要朋友可以参考下Queue模块保持线程同步利用Queue对象先进先出特性,将每个生产者数据一次存入队列,而每个消费者将依次从队列中取出数据import threading
最近一段时间,在做数据ETL相关事,结合实践以及自己思考,记录下来,以做参考。 概述 一般来说,数据团队自己是很少生产数据,一般都是对业务线数据进行分析加工,从而让数据产生价值。一方面,业务线数据会存到关系数据(如mysql),磁盘(日志)等存储介质;另一方面,基于大数据分析一般会将数据存储到hdfs,hbase,es。因此,不可避免地我们需要在这些不同存储介质间
转载 2023-07-07 11:24:24
107阅读
# PyCharm 同步 Docker 环境 在现代软件开发中,使用容器技术来管理和部署应用变得越来越普遍。Docker 是最流行容器化平台之一,能够提供轻量、可移植运行环境。同时,PyCharm 作为一个强大 Python IDE,能够帮助开发者在 Docker 环境下高效地工作。本文将探讨如何在 PyCharm同步 Docker 环境,并提供相应代码示例和图示。 ## PyCh
原创 2024-08-15 10:21:49
43阅读
同步变量也是变量;分为两种:计数器、标示符。 条件变量存在是为了解决类似switch执行线程结构问题。 同步:标示检查; 变量:变量、结构、操作。 总结起来就是检查状态以决定是否放行。 同步变量与线程关系:从变量角度看,是一对多映射;所以内部极有可能是hashmap实现; 同时,线程
转载 2018-04-11 22:59:00
164阅读
2评论
1. 同步与互斥(1)互斥与同步机制是计算机系统中,用于控制进程对某些特定资源(共享资源)访问机制(2)同步是指用于实现控制多个进程按照一定规则或顺序访问某些系统资源机制。(3)互斥是指用于实现控制某些系统资源在任意时刻只能允许一个进程访问机制。互斥是同步机制中一种特殊情况。(4)同步机制是linux操作系统可以高效稳定运行重要机制 2. Linux系统并发主要来源  在操
# PyCharm同步数据到Docker 在现代软件开发中,Docker已成为一种普遍使用工具,能够帮助开发者构建、部署和管理应用容器。而PyCharm作为一个强大IDE,可以显著提高我们在Docker环境中开发和调试代码效率。在这篇文章中,我们将详细探讨如何使用PyCharm将数据同步到Docker容器中,并介绍相关代码示例和一些最佳实践。 ## 什么是Docker? Docker
原创 9月前
38阅读
原文地址:http://zhidao.baidu.com/link?url=0P7DGHosch8byrCXK1lMcOkJ2LGqlP3ptVhDVbmkM4MKRRMW4z8m2anrbzJYjdtHyB_ebftbgUlxYnEdYYNEbrXW4IyfNhUTdBSf2YyKQ8_略有修改1.下载Git2.Pycharm中设置GitHub账号密码 Pref...
转载 2021-06-16 19:49:26
716阅读
方法1 导出配置文件,在新电脑上导入配置文件 方法2 使用pycharm软件自带备份功能(sync) 在file-settings-backup and sync,登录你账户后,ok即可。 pycharm版本:2025.1.2
原创 2月前
71阅读
# 使用 PyCharm 连接 Impala 并同步 Hive 数据 在现代数据处理和分析中,很多公司选择使用 Apache Hive 和 Impala。Hive 提供了数据仓库服务,允许使用 SQL 风格查询语言来处理大数据,而 Impala 则提供了更快 SQL 查询能力,因此,在数据分析过程中,常常需要将这两者结合使用。本文将指导你如何在 PyCharm 中连接 Impala并同步
原创 7月前
51阅读
# 用PyCharm同步Hive元数据:全面指南 在大数据领域,Hive作为一种数据仓库工具,可以方便地存储、查询和管理海量数据。为了高效地同步和管理Hive元数据,许多开发者选择使用PyCharm作为他们集成开发环境(IDE)。本文将深入探讨如何在PyCharm同步Hive元数据, 并提供一些代码示例,以及状态图和类图说明。 ## 什么是Hive元数据? Hive元数据是指Hive
原创 7月前
89阅读
一、消息种类关于Handler机制基本原理不了解可以看这里: Handler机制源码解析。Message分为3种:普通消息(同步消息)、屏障消息(同步屏障)和异步消息。我们通常使用都是普通消息,而屏障消息就是在消息队列中插入一个屏障,在屏障之后所有普通消息都会被挡着,不能被处理。不过异步消息却例外,屏障不会挡住异步消息,因此可以这样认为:屏障消息就是为了确保异步消息优先级,设置了屏障后,只
什么是Handler同步屏障Handler中Message可以分为两类:同步消息、异步消息。消息类型可以通过以下函数得知//Message.java public boolean isAsynchronous() { return (flags & FLAG_ASYNCHRONOUS) != 0; }一般情况下这两种消息处理方式没什么区别,在设置了同步屏障时才会出现差异。Ha
转载 2023-10-19 09:43:49
53阅读
本篇中,我们来看一看传统同步实现方式以及这背后原理。很多人都知道,在Java多线程编程中,有一个重要关键字,synchronized。但是很多人看到这个东西会感到困惑:“都说同步机制是通过对象锁来实现,但是这么一个关键字,我也看不出来Java程序锁住了哪个对象阿?“没错,我一开始也是对这个问题感到困惑和不解。不过还好,我们有下面的这个例程:1. public class ThreadTes
更新日志2020.05.22 增加了 docker 中使用 gpu 相关文字和配图2020.06.03 增加了挂载数据目录到 docker 中相关说明2021.10.25 更新失效链接2022.02.22 经测试发现,Pycharm 2021.01,2021.02 版本会出现配置错误,初步分析可能是 Pycharm 自身 Bug,目前尚未找到解决办法。 Pycharm 2021.01 版本报错
  • 1
  • 2
  • 3
  • 4
  • 5